Xbox co-founder calls Game Pass price hike a ‘betrayal’

Longtime Xbox enthusiasts have recently seen several old exclusive games come to PlayStation 5, while Microsoft has increased prices for Game Pass and Xbox consoles in the United States. Now, one of the original members of the Xbox team, Laura Fryer, is speaking out against her former employer and describing the price increases as a “betrayal” of the trust gamers placed in them.

“With this latest increase in Game Pass, Xbox has lost one of its last advantages,” Fryer said in his latest YouTube video. “It was the best deal in gaming… With these price hikes it feels like a betrayal, like greed for gaming… I recognize that this generation of Xbox consoles is not over yet, it will almost certainly be remembered first and foremost for Microsoft’s greed.”

Fryer then recapped this generation’s two hardware price increases, three separate Game Pass price increases, more expensive games, massive layoffs, and multiple studio layoffs.

“I think all these changes and drama will hurt the Microsoft brand,” Fryer said. “It seems like Xbox is moving toward cloud gaming and away from hardware, but it could also be that they’re just incompetent, they just don’t understand what they’re doing… They need to rebuild trust with players and fans. I know people on the Xbox team who are still there and were there in the beginning… They can fix this and I support them and wish them the best.”

Fryer previously shared his belief that Xbox was abandoning hardware by outsourcing ROG Xbox Ally handheld devices to Asus. Xbox VP Jason Ronald reiterated the company’s commitment to its next-gen hardware earlier this year.

Following the recent Game Pass announcement, Microsoft revealed that the price increases would not take effect immediately for all players. But the more expensive version of Game Pass loses a fan-favorite Call of Duty perk. Some analysts believe an ad-supported Game Pass service will be added in the future.
